How much do intercom security j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 24, 2026, the average hourly pay for intercom security in the United States is $26.61,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$21.15 and $30.53 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are some common challenges faced by Intercom Security professionals, and how can they be addressed?

Intercom Security professionals often encounter challenges such as managing high volumes of visitor verification, responding to technical malfunctions, and ensuring secure communication between entry points and security teams. Staying alert and maintaining clear, professional communication is essential, especially during peak hours or emergencies. Regular training on new intercom technologies and protocols, as well as collaborating closely with building management and IT staff, can help address these challenges effectively.

What is an intercom security system?

An intercom security system is a communication device installed at entry points of buildings or facilities that allows occupants to communicate with visitors before granting access. These systems often include audio and/or video capabilities, enabling users to see and speak with visitors for added security. Intercom security systems can be standalone or integrated with other security measures, such as door locks and surveillance cameras, to control and monitor entry points efficiently. They are commonly used in residential buildings, offices, schools, and other facilities that require controlled access.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an Intercom Security professional,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Intercom Security professional, you need a solid understanding of security protocols, electronic access control, and basic electrical systems, often supported by relevant technical training or certifications. Familiarity with intercom systems, CCTV, alarm panels, and related software is typically required. Strong attention to detail, effective communication, and problem-solving skills help you excel in responding to security issues and customer inquiries. These abilities ensure the safety and efficiency of building access control, providing reliable protection for property and occupants.

Position Description

Dunbar Security Solutions is seeking a Residential Concierge Security Officer to support daily operations at a residential community in Virginia Beach. This position combines lobby reception responsibilities with routine security functions to help maintain an organized and secure atmosphere for residents, visitors, contractors, and staff.

The ideal candidate is approachable, dependable, and capable of balancing customer interaction with strong attention to property security procedures.

Primary Duties

Resident & Guest Services

  • Welcome residents, visitors, and vendors entering the property
  • Verify guest access through identification checks and resident approval procedures
  • Coordinate visitor entry using phones, intercom systems, or building communication tools
  • Assist with questions, directions, and general resident support when appropriate

Property Access & Monitoring

  • Help maintain secure access throughout the building and common areas
  • Observe entry points, lobby traffic, and surrounding activity during assigned shifts
  • Monitor surveillance equipment and report unusual situations or safety concerns
  • Respond to alarms, disturbances, or unexpected activity following site procedures

Package & Delivery Coordination

  • Accept and document incoming deliveries using designated tracking systems
  • Organize package storage and assist with resident notification procedures
  • Coordinate courier and food delivery access based on property guidelines
  • Deliver packages to units when required by management procedures

Patrol & Reporting Responsibilities

  • Complete scheduled walkthroughs of hallways, entrances, parking areas, and amenities
  • Prepare detailed activity reports, incident documentation, and shift notes
  • Assist with monitoring building-related concerns when directed by management
  • Carry out additional responsibilities as assigned by supervisors

Minimum Qualifications

  • Must be at least 18 years of age
  • Ability to work a flexible rotating schedule, including overnight shifts
  • Strong interpersonal and communication skills
  • Basic computer knowledge for report entry and package tracking
  • Reliable attendance and professional presentation
  • Ability to remain calm and professional during high-traffic situations

Preferred Qualifications

  • Previous experience in concierge security, residential communities, hospitality, or customer service
  • Familiarity with access control systems, visitor management software, or CCTV monitoring
  • Experience preparing written reports or documenting incidents
